Advertisement
Guest User

Untitled

a guest
Mar 10th, 2016
45
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Batch 1.55 KB | None | 0 0
  1. :: Download FPC 3.0.0 32 bits (fpc-3.0.0.i386-win32.exe): ftp://ftp.hu.freepascal.org/pub/fpc/dist/3.0.0/i386-win32/fpc-3.0.0.i386-win32.exe
  2. :: Download FPC 3.0.0 64 bits (fpc-3.0.0.i386-win32.cross.x86_64-win64.exe): ftp://ftp.hu.freepascal.org/pub/fpc/dist/3.0.0/x86_64-win64/fpc-3.0.0.i386-win32.cross.x86_64-win64.exe
  3. ::
  4. :: Install fpc-3.0.0.i386-win32.exe and fpc-3.0.0.i386-win32.cross.x86_64-win64.exe over (no problem)
  5.  
  6. set path=C:\FPC\3.0.0\bin\i386-win32
  7. :: git clone https://github.com/graemeg/freepascal.git
  8. cd C:\dev\git\freepascal
  9. make clean all
  10. make install PREFIX=C:\dev\git\freepascal
  11. make all OS_TARGET=win64 CPU_TARGET=x86_64
  12. make crossinstall OS_TARGET=win64 CPU_TARGET=x86_64 PREFIX=C:\dev\git\freepascal
  13. cd C:\dev\git\freepascal\bin\i386-win32
  14. fpcmkcfg -d basepath=C:\dev\git\freepascal -o .\fpc.cfg
  15. :: Download 32 files from: http://svn.freepascal.org/svn/fpcbuild/trunk/install/binw32/
  16. copy C:\dev\backup\fpc\trunk\binw32\*.* C:\dev\git\freepascal\bin\i386-win32 /y
  17. :: Download 17 files from: http://svn.freepascal.org/svn/fpcbuild/trunk/install/binw64/
  18. copy C:\dev\backup\fpc\trunk\binw64\*.* C:\dev\git\freepascal\bin\i386-win32 /y
  19. :: Download the two files from: http://svn.freepascal.org/svn/lazarus/binaries/x86_64-win64/gdb/bin/
  20. mkdir C:\dev\git\freepascal\bin\x86_64-win64
  21. copy C:\dev\backup\gdb\win64\*.* C:\dev\git\freepascal\bin\x86_64-win64 /y
  22.  
  23. set path=C:\dev\git\freepascal\bin\i386-win32
  24. :: git clone https://github.com/graemeg/lazarus.git
  25. cd C:\dev\git\lazarus
  26. :: make clean all OPT="-glw2"
  27. make bigide OPT="-glw2"
  28.  
  29. pause
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ement